A better understanding of the potential impact of AI and clouds on energy consumption will enable informed decisions today regarding investments in energy sources, ensuring adequate supplies to meet the energy needs of the future.
Artificial intelligence has emerged as one of the most transformative technologies of the modern era, reshaping industries and influencing daily life in unprecedented ways. The growth of AI and the expansion of data centers are contributing to a surge in energy demand, leading to concerns about the impact on environmental sustainability and climate change. While the focus has primarily been on transitioning to clean energy supply sources, the discussion on future demand growth has been overlooked particularly in terms of understanding and predicting AI and cloud energy needs in the coming decade.
